\n" ); document.write( "I'm not sure I can figure out how you got the answer you did. So I will not be able to explain what went wrong. But your Math book is correct.

\n" ); document.write( "Your expression is a 4th root. And to simplify a 4th root you look for factors of the radicand (the expression within the radical) that are 4th powers. (Other factors are of no real interest.)

\n" ); document.write( "For 243 there may be many ways to factor it but one way, 81*3, involves a factor that is a 4th power. (\"81+=+3%5E4\") For the variables we factor each one into as many powers of 4 as we can. Putting all these factors together we get:
\n" ); document.write( "\"root%284%2C+3%5E4%2A3%2Ax%5E4%2Ax%5E4%2Ay%5E4%2Ay%5E4%2Ay%5E2%29\"
\n" ); document.write( "Take a moment to make sure you see how your original radicand and the factored one you see above are equal to each other.

\n" ); document.write( "Next, I like to use the Commutative Property of Multiplication to reorder the factors so that all the 4th powers are in front:
\n" ); document.write( "\"root%284%2C+3%5E4%2Ax%5E4%2Ax%5E4%2Ay%5E4%2Ay%5E4%2A3%2Ay%5E2%29\"
\n" ); document.write( "Next we use a property of radicals, \"root%28a%2C+p%2Aq%29+=+root%28a%2C+p%29%2Aroot%28a%2C+q%29\" to separate all the 4th power factors into their own radicals. (The factors that are not 4th powers (at the end) just stay all in the same radical.):

\n" ); document.write( "Now all the 4th roots of the 4th powers simplify:
\n" ); document.write( "\"3%2Ax%2Ax%2Ay%2Ay%2Aroot%284%2C+3y%5E2%29\"
\n" ); document.write( "which simplifies to:
\n" ); document.write( "\"3%2Ax%5E2%2Ay%5E2%2Aroot%284%2C+3y%5E2%29\"
\n" ); document.write( "which is the answer in your book.
